No spoilers here, just a typical love story that actually have some funny characters who devleope throughout the story. This is the sequel to "Dear Ruth". Dear Ruth was a story of how a little sister writing love letters to a member of the Armed Forces and pretended to be her older sister. Well you know it would work out so now we have Dear Wife which tells the story of how their relationship progresses with all of the housing shortages after WWII. There is another movie in this trilogy, I think it is called Dear Brat. The center of attention is focused on the younger sister. From the bestselling author of The Marriage Lie comes a riveting new novel of suspense about a woman who must decide just how far she’ll go to escape the person she once loved Beth Murphy is on the run… For nearly a year, Beth has been planning for her escape. She's thought through everything -- a new look, new name and new city -- because one small slip and her husband will find her. Sabine Hardison is missing… A couple hundred miles away, Jeffrey returns home from a work trip to find his wife, Sabine, is missing. Wherever she is, she’s taken almost nothing with her. Her abandoned car is the only evidence the police have, and all signs point to foul play. As the police search for leads, the case becomes more and more convoluted. Sabine’s carefully laid plans for her future indicate trouble at home, and a husband who would be better off with her gone. But are things really as clear cut as they seem? Where is Sabine? And who is Beth? The only thing that’s certain is that someone is lying and the truth won’t stay buried for long. Don't miss Kimberly Belle's newest novel, My Darling Husband!

Kimberly Belle is the USA Today and Wall Street Journal bestselling author of four novels of suspense. Her third, The Marriage Lie, was a semifinalist in the 2017 Goodreads Choice Awards for Best Mystery & Thriller and has been translated into a dozen languages. A graduate of Agnes Scott College, Kimberly worked in marketing and nonprofit fundraising before turning to writing fiction. She divides her time between Atlanta and Amsterdam. SUMMARY This book, told from the points of view of Jeffrey, a man whose wife has disappeared; Marcus, the police detective assigned to find Jeffrey’s wife and Beth (her alias), the woman running from her husband. The story opens with “Beth” hightailing it out of town while her husband is away on business. She is terrified of what will happen if he catches her. Beth has spent months meticulously planning her escape complete with a new identity and a trail of false leads for him to follow. As the story progresses, she recounts the years of abuse she suffered and how she finally got the courage to leave. Even when it finally looks like Beth has finally found a safe place to hide, she is constantly looking over her shoulder with the certainty that he will find her. It sort of reminded me of Julia Roberts in Sleeping with the Enemy. Jeffrey and his wife had gotten into a huge fight, which ended up getting physical, just before he had to leave town for a work event. When he returns, she is missing and no one has any idea where she went. Of course, with their rocky marriage and the hint of abuse, Jeffrey is suspect #1 on the police’s list. Since he’s a very unlikeable guy, it’s hard to feel any sympathy his predicament. It’s even kind of fun to watch him being the prime suspect. The third point of view comes from the detective assigned to the case, Marcus. Marcus is working nonstop to find Jeffreys missing wife, Sabine. He and Jeffrey clash pretty immediately. All the evidence points toward Jeffrey, his iradkic behavior is not helping him, neither is the fact that he won’t tell Marcus anything about what happened to Sabine.
